| Scientific
Name : |
Crescentia
cujete |
| Family
: |
Bignoniaceae |
| Common Name
: |
Beggar's bowl |
| |
| The hard-shelled fruit
cut in to half looks like a bowl; hence the
common name. It is a small tree. Peculiar
shaped flowers have brown stripes and grow
on the main trunk & mature branches. Fruits
are large but not edible. |
| |
| Propagation
: |
Seeds |
| Longevity
: |
Perennial |
